In 1918, the average family income in the United States was approximately $1,500 per year. This figure varied significantly based on factors such as location and occupation. The economic landscape was affected by World War I, which had recently concluded, and the subsequent transition to a peacetime economy. Overall, the average income reflected the economic conditions of the time, including inflation and the cost of living.
The average price of a new home in 1940 was 3,920.00 dollars. By 1949, the average price of a new home went up to 7,450.00 dollars.
